It's still a tough hike, but the Cholla Trail is a nicer way to hike Camelback Mountain, which is a must-do Phoenix walking (camelback mountain arizona). Regarding 450,000 people a year hike Camelback Mountain, and it can seem like all of them are with you on the route if you leave at the incorrect time.

There are about 200 search and also rescue initiatives in Phoenix, with the bulk of those occurring at Camelback Mountain. The two main factors why hikers get in trouble is the warmth, as well as from going off trail (intentionally or accidentally).



Don't park on Cholla Lane or you'll be pulled. Signs on the street lead you to Cholla Path. Stroll to the edge of East Cholla Lane and Invergorden Road, this is where my walking gas mileage starts.

Is Camelback Mountain a Hard Walking? Credit Scores: Olly Levine, Unsplash In basic, a Camelback hill hike is thought about hard. Beginners will certainly be able to check out the foothills of the mountains as well as obtain several of the benefits of this amazing old monolith. However, if you're wanting to dominate the hill as well as reach its optimal, after that beware.

A lot of professionals suggest that you allow in between 2 as well as three hrs for the overall hike. If you want to take an excellent amount of breaks, then offer on your own five hrs.

If you follow the routes, the overall distance isn't that long. The main two treking trails are just under 2. 5 miles (4 kilometres) each, indicating a five-mile round trip (8 kilometres). This could not seem like much but you need to bear in mind simply exactly how high this hill is.

One route is slightly shorter than the other so you might be tempted to take this one. However, it's vital to bear in mind that it's just much shorter since it takes a more direct path up the hill. Consequently, it's normally best to take the much longer one. The distinction isn't that much in terms of distance however the shorter path is absolutely a lot easier.
